Cardinals Add QB Kedon Slovis to 53-Man Roster

The Arizona Cardinals have made a significant roster move ahead of their game against the Indianapolis Colts. With quarterback Kyler Murray listed as questionable, the team signed Kedon Slovis from their practice squad.

By adding Kedon Slovis to the active roster, the Cardinals enhance their quarterback depth. Slovis will serve as a backup to Jacoby Brissett. He can also function as an emergency third quarterback if Murray cannot play.

Background on Kedon Slovis

Kedon Slovis joined the Cardinals’ practice squad in August after being released by the Houston Texans. In 2024, he spent time on Houston’s practice squad. Before that, he was part of the Indianapolis Colts after going undrafted in that same year.

Additional Roster Changes

  • The Cardinals placed punter Blake Gillikin on injured reserve.
  • Defensive linemen Zach Carter and Anthony Goodlow have been elevated from the practice squad.
  • Bilal Nichols was ruled out due to personal reasons.
